Ferrari 312B3 car scale model kit:
The 1974 Ferrari 312B was a great single-seater, which even on circuits that were not theoretically favorable for it, used to share the first starting line. The homogeneity of the chassis-engine combination of the new Ferrari made this model the best single-seater of the year, although the drivers' and constructors' titles eluded Ferrari. There was also a revolution in terms of the drivers, with Ickx being replaced by a rising figure, Niki Lauda, and reliing on Regazzonni instead of Merzario as second driver. And in order for the competition department to work better in terms of coordination, Agnelli sent a young man he trusted from Fiat's legal department named Luca de Montezemolo.
The twelve-cylinder Boxer engine continued to evolve under the direction of engineer Rocchi, which for the 1974 season produced some 480 hp at 12,400 rpm, some 20 hp more than the Cosworth, although with slightly lower maximum torque.

Undoubtedly, the Italian brand
Tameo Kits is the reference in the world of scale modeling for F1 lovers, with hundreds of 1/43 scale models (even some in 1/24 scale) with different levels of detail, from simple models to focus on the most visible parts, to the most detailed models with fully detailed engines... there are even some references including the tools used in the pit box. Their catalog also includes some of the great prototypes of the 70s, street sports cars, as well as a complete listing of spare decals and accessories.
